About this House

Ready for immediate move-in! Gorgeous Northpark Square townhome offering 3 bedrooms, 3 bathrooms, and 1,907sf living space with a two-car oversized attached garage and direct entry. This two-story home features a rare main-floor bedroom with full bath, ideal for guests, multigenerational living, or a home office. The living room includes a cozy fireplace, recessed lighting, and plantation shutters. The open kitchen offers stainless steel appliances, including refrigerator along with ample cabinet and counter space. Upstairs features a spacious primary suite with walk-in closets, dual vanity sinks, and separate soaking tub and shower. Convenient upstairs laundry room with sink. The home is in turnkey, with fresh paint. Located near award-winning Beckman High School and close to shopping, parks, and biking and walking trails. A must-see property in a highly desirable Northpark Square community.
